Softwareentwicklung

8
Gibt es so etwas wie Feature Bloat?

Ich bin auf den Ausdruck "Software Bloat" gestoßen, aber ist dies eine echte Sache, oder sollten wir lieber über Dinge wie Leistungsprobleme, Speicher- und Festplatten-Footprint, Benutzererfahrung und On-Demand-Installation sprechen? Was fehlt mir

8
Öffentliche und private Repositories

Angenommen, ich entwickle eine App zum Verkauf. Ist es sinnvoll, für dieses Projekt ein öffentliches Repository zu verwenden? Schützt das Standard-Copyright den Code nicht vor anderen Personen, die ihn verwenden? Wenn ja, welche Vorteile bietet die Bezahlung eines privaten

8
Gibt es dafür eine Open Source Lizenz?

Ich habe zu Hause, in meiner Freizeit und mit meinem eigenen Wissen und meiner eigenen Ausrüstung Code geschrieben, ohne Vertrag oder NDA. Ich möchte diesen Code Open Source machen, damit ich ihn in Software verwenden kann, die ich für einen Arbeitgeber schreibe, ohne mir das Recht zu verweigern,...

8
Wann ist eine 'Kern'-Bibliothek eine schlechte Idee?

Bei der Entwicklung von Software habe ich häufig eine zentralisierte 'Kern'-Bibliothek mit handlichem Code, der von verschiedenen Projekten gemeinsam genutzt und referenziert werden kann. Beispiele: eine Reihe von Funktionen zum Bearbeiten von Zeichenfolgen häufig verwendete reguläre Ausdrücke...

8
Wie ich meinen Handel verbessern kann

Ich arbeite zurzeit als Softwareentwickler und studiere für einen Abschluss in Software-Engineering (ersteres, während ich letzteres nicht mache). Ich bin zuversichtlich, dass ich meine Arbeit kompetent erledigen kann, aber ich denke, ich könnte es besser machen. Ich weiß, dass meine größte Gefahr...

8
Wie werde ich ein JavaScript-Ninja? [geschlossen]

Diese Frage passt derzeit nicht zu unserem Q & A-Format. Wir erwarten, dass die Antworten durch Fakten, Referenzen oder Fachwissen gestützt werden, aber diese Frage wird wahrscheinlich zu Debatten, Argumenten, Umfragen oder erweiterten Diskussionen führen. Wenn Sie der Meinung sind, dass diese...

8
Inwiefern hat Delphi die C # -Sprache beeinflusst?

Ich suche speziell nach sprachlichen Einflüssen (im Gegensatz zu Framework). Auf den ersten Blick scheint C # eine Weiterentwicklung von C / C ++ oder Java zu sein. Aber wir wissen, dass C # den gleichen Designer wie Delphi hat, und er erkannte sogar einige Ähnlichkeiten an und sagte: "Gute Ideen...

8
Daten-Unsortierungs- / Homogenitätsalgorithmus

Um ein Rad nicht neu zu erfinden, frage ich, ob jemand Ideen zu einem Datenhomogenitätsalgorithmus hat. Ein kurzes Beispiel: Meine Daten haben vielleicht mehrere Elemente wie Nummer Farbe Obst Brief Es gibt ungefähr 100 dieser Elemente in einem Array. Der Algorithmus muss die Elemente so...

8
Selen und nicht technische Teammitglieder

Ich arbeite in einem Team, das eine Website mit einer großen Anzahl von Seiten entwickelt. Der QA-Mitarbeiter im Team führt derzeit alle Tests manuell durch. Ich denke daran, dass er eine Reihe von Selenium-Skripten erstellt. Ich glaube nicht, dass er alle Tests automatisieren kann, aber er könnte...